Unforgettable Natural Wonders

Jeju Island is renowned for its stunning natural landscapes, which include lush green mountains, pristine beaches, and dramatic cliffs. One of the most iconic spots is Hallasan National Park, home to Hallasan, the highest mountain in South Korea. Visitors can hike through lush forests, witness breathtaking waterfalls, and enjoy panoramic views from the summit. Another must-see is Manjanggul Cave, a UNESCO World Heritage site known for its impressive lava tube formations and beautiful rock formations illuminated by colorful lights.

For those seeking relaxation, the island’s beaches offer a perfect escape. Songaksan Lighthouse Beach and Hamdeok Beach are favorites among locals and tourists alike, providing clear waters and soft sands for sunbathing and swimming. The island’s natural beauty is not just confined to its land; Jeju’s surrounding waters are also teeming with marine life, making it an ideal spot for snorkeling and diving adventures.

Cultural Richness and Traditional Experiences

Beyond its natural attractions, Jeju Island boasts a rich cultural heritage that is deeply intertwined with its history and local customs. The island is famous for its Haenyeo, or female divers, who have traditionally harvested seafood from the sea without the use of oxygen tanks. Today, visitors can learn about this unique tradition at the Haenyeo Museum and even try their hand at diving in guided tours.

Jeju’s cultural tapestry is further enriched by its traditional villages, such as Seongsan Village, where visitors can explore well-preserved hanok houses and learn about the island’s agricultural past. The Jeju Folk Village offers a glimpse into the island’s folk culture, showcasing traditional performances, crafts, and cuisine. For a taste of local flavors, don’t miss the chance to savor Jeju’s famous specialties like black pork and jeon (Korean savory pancakes).

Adventure and Leisure Activities

Jeju Island caters to all types of travelers, from thrill-seekers to leisure enthusiasts. Adventure lovers can enjoy activities such as paragliding over the island’s picturesque landscapes, riding ATVs across rugged terrains, or taking a hot air balloon ride for a bird’s-eye view of the island. For those looking for a more relaxed experience, Jeju offers a variety of spas and wellness centers, where visitors can indulge in traditional Korean treatments and unwind amidst nature.

The island is also home to several theme parks and entertainment venues, including Jeju Loveland, a sculpture park that celebrates human relationships and love in a whimsical and artistic manner. Meanwhile, Jeju Olle Trail provides a series of walking paths that wind through the island’s countryside, offering hikers a chance to explore Jeju’s natural beauty at a leisurely pace.
